god okay this might sound totally ridiculous, but do you know of a good source for finding the names of all the beyond evil characters? cause i'm trying to write my first fic for the fandom, but literally the names are spelled differently everywhere i look. like, for example, sometimes its dongsik. but sometimes it's also dong-sik, or dong sik, or dong shik. and ngl, it's stressing me out.
oh, not a ridiculous question at all! i personally go to asianwiki for the names of characters who i might not remember quite as well (ie. i needed to look up the name of kang do su's wife, im seon nyeo...i remember liking her character a lot, but they also don't say her name a whole ton, so that's why i was glad this page existed.)
in terms of name consistency: i personally like putting a space between the characters' name syllables (so "Dong Sik" instead of "dongsik" or "dong-sik") just because i feel like that's the closest in terms of authenticity, only because one of my korean friends pointed out that a lot of people feel the need to put the syllables together or hyphenate names as some way to appease westerners...which....i can understand that perspective, but idk? as a korean-american, i'm not entirely bothered by it (for example, i spell the romanization of my own korean name as one name--"hyejin" instead of "hye jin"). but when it comes to writing fic, i guess that thing my friend told me stuck with me, which is why i separate the syllables. (that said though, i'm not very offended by those who stick the syllables together, and i don't think most people are bothered by it either).
in terms of more specific character names: i would very much go with "dong sik" over "dong shik" just because the subtitles in more common streaming platforms like netflix or viki use "dong sik", i believe. i personally also prefer "joo won" over "ju won" just mostly out of personal preferences?
